Question 1: What does AQL stand for in acceptance sampling per ANSI/ASQ Z1.4?
- Allowable Quality Level
- Acceptance Quality Limit (Correct answer)
- Average Quality Loss
- Adjusted Quality Level
Correct answer: Acceptance Quality Limit
AQL stands for Acceptance Quality Limit, defined as the quality level that is the worst tolerable process average when a continuing series of lots is submitted for acceptance sampling.
Question 2: In a single sampling plan, a lot is rejected when the number of defectives found in the sample is:
- Equal to the acceptance number (Ac)
- Less than or equal to the acceptance number (Ac)
- Greater than the acceptance number (Ac) (Correct answer)
- Equal to half the rejection number (Re)
Correct answer: Greater than the acceptance number (Ac)
A lot is rejected when the number of defectives exceeds the acceptance number (Ac), meaning the rejection number (Re) is typically Ac + 1.
Question 3: The Operating Characteristic (OC) curve of a sampling plan illustrates the relationship between:
- Sample size and lot size
- Probability of lot acceptance and incoming lot quality (Correct answer)
- AQL and LTPD values
- Producer's risk and consumer's risk
Correct answer: Probability of lot acceptance and incoming lot quality
The OC curve plots the probability of accepting a lot (Pa) against the actual lot fraction defective, showing how well the sampling plan discriminates between good and bad lots.
Question 4: The producer's risk (α) in acceptance sampling is the probability of:
- Accepting a lot at the LTPD quality level
- Rejecting a lot that meets the AQL (Correct answer)
- Finding zero defects in the sample
- Accepting a lot with defects above the AOQL
Correct answer: Rejecting a lot that meets the AQL
Producer's risk (α) is the probability that a good lot meeting the AQL is incorrectly rejected, representing the risk borne by the supplier.
Question 5: In acceptance sampling, the AQL represents:
- The worst average process quality level still considered acceptable (Correct answer)
- The maximum defect level permitted in any single lot
- The quality level at which 50% of submitted lots are accepted
- The minimum sample size required for inspection
Correct answer: The worst average process quality level still considered acceptable
The AQL is the worst tolerable process average quality level for a continuing series of lots; lots at AQL quality have a high probability of acceptance.
Question 6: In a double sampling plan, if the number of defectives in the first sample falls between Ac1 and Re1, the inspector should:
- Accept the lot immediately
- Reject the lot immediately
- Draw a second sample and combine results (Correct answer)
- Place the lot on hold pending supplier response
Correct answer: Draw a second sample and combine results
When first-sample results are inconclusive (between Ac1 and Re1), a second sample is drawn and the combined defectives from both samples are compared to Ac2 and Re2.
Question 7: Under ANSI/ASQ Z1.4, which inspection level is used as the default unless otherwise specified?
- Level I
- Level II (Correct answer)
- Level III
- Level S-1
Correct answer: Level II
Inspection Level II is the default general inspection level in ANSI/ASQ Z1.4 and provides a balanced trade-off between sample size and discrimination.
